How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Wataga?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Wataga Studio Apartments | $886 | $698 | $999 |
| Wataga 1 Bedroom Apartments | $990 | $670 | $1,600 |
| Wataga 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,094 | $525 | $1,712 |
| Wataga 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,304 | $915 | $1,599 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Wataga
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Wataga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Wataga ranges from $670 to $1,600 with an average monthly rent of $990.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Wataga c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Wataga range from $525 to $1,712.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,094.
How expensive are Wataga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 14 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Wataga on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$915 to $1,599 - averaging $1,304 for the location.
